Product Name Cyanamide
(Synonyms: Hydrogen Cyanamide; Carbamonitrile; Cyanoamine)
CAS NO. 420-04-2
Formula & Molecular Weight CH2N2 (MW: 42.04)
Chemical Structure Cyanamide Hydrogen Cyanamide molecular structure CAS 420-04-2
Product Positioning NCN Building Block / Pharmaceutical Intermediate / Agrochemical Intermediate
Cyanamide is a small but highly reactive nitrogen-containing molecule capable of participating in nucleophilic and electrophilic chemistry. It is widely used as an upstream building block in pharmaceutical, agrochemical and fine chemical synthesis.

Why does Dicyandiamide (DCD) matter in Cyanamide?

Cyanamide can undergo dimerization to form Dicyandiamide, particularly under unfavorable chemical or storage conditions. For this reason, DCD is an important quality parameter when evaluating Cyanamide for process-sensitive applications. Customers should specify their required DCD limit when requesting a quotation.

Cyanamide Stability: Why Stabilizer, pH and Storage Matter

Dimerization Cyanamide can dimerize to Dicyandiamide under alkaline conditions.
Hydration Under unsuitable acidic conditions, hydration reactions can lead toward urea formation.
Stabilizer Commercial Cyanamide grades are therefore commonly stabilized. Stabilizer type and level should be considered when matching a grade to a downstream process.
Storage Storage conditions are grade-specific. Keep containers tightly closed and follow the temperature, compatibility and handling requirements stated in the SDS applicable to the supplied commercial grade.

Key Applications of Cyanamide

Pharmaceutical Synthesis Cyanamide is used as an NCN building block in pharmaceutical synthesis. Current industrial application references associate Cyanamide chemistry with products such as Albendazole, Fenbendazole and Imatinib.
Agrochemical Synthesis Cyanamide is used in the synthesis of nitrogen-containing crop-protection intermediates. Industry application references include chemistry associated with Amitrole, Pyrimethanil and Sulfoxaflor.
Creatine & Creatine Monohydrate A well-established industrial route produces Creatine or Creatine Monohydrate by reacting Cyanamide with sodium or potassium sarcosinate. For this application, Cyanamide assay, DCD, stabilizer and other impurities may influence downstream process and purification requirements.
Guanidine & NCN Chemistry The difunctional nature of Cyanamide makes it a useful precursor for guanidine-related compounds, nitrogen-rich intermediates and heterocyclic chemistry.
Plant Growth Regulator Active Ingredient Hydrogen Cyanamide is used as the active ingredient in registered plant growth regulator products in certain markets for dormancy management and more uniform bud break in crops such as grapes, kiwifruit and orchard crops. Agricultural use is registration- and label-specific.

Cyanamide vs Dicyandiamide vs Calcium Cyanamide

Product Identity Key Difference
Cyanamide CAS 420-04-2 / CH2N2 Reactive NCN building block supplied as stabilized solution or crystal grade.
Dicyandiamide CAS 461-58-5 A different NCN compound and a potential dimerization product of Cyanamide; also a separate commercial chemical.
Calcium Cyanamide Separate calcium-containing compound Not the same substance as Cyanamide / Hydrogen Cyanamide. Always verify the CAS number before sourcing.

Frequently Asked Questions

What is Cyanamide? Cyanamide is a reactive nitrogen-containing compound with CAS 420-04-2 and molecular formula CH2N2. It is widely used as an upstream building block in pharmaceutical, agrochemical and fine chemical synthesis.
Are Cyanamide and Hydrogen Cyanamide the same compound? Yes. In commercial and technical use, Cyanamide and Hydrogen Cyanamide commonly refer to the same substance with CAS 420-04-2.
What is the difference between Cyanamide 50% solution and crystal grade? The main differences are active Cyanamide concentration, introduced water, stabilizer system and impurity profile. Grade selection should be based on the customer's reaction system and target specification.
Why is Dicyandiamide controlled in Cyanamide? Cyanamide can dimerize to form Dicyandiamide. DCD therefore serves as an important quality parameter and may affect downstream reaction and purification requirements.
Why is Cyanamide stabilized? Cyanamide is chemically reactive and can undergo degradation or self-reaction under unsuitable conditions. Commercial grades are commonly stabilized to improve product stability during storage and handling.
How is Cyanamide used in Creatine synthesis? A documented industrial route reacts Cyanamide with sodium or potassium sarcosinate to produce Creatine or Creatine Monohydrate.
What pharmaceutical applications use Cyanamide? Cyanamide is used as a nitrogen-containing building block in pharmaceutical synthesis. Current industry application references include Albendazole, Fenbendazole and Imatinib chemistry.
What agrochemical applications use Cyanamide? Cyanamide is used as a building block in crop-protection chemistry. Current industry application references include Amitrole, Pyrimethanil and Sulfoxaflor.
Is Hydrogen Cyanamide a plant growth regulator? Hydrogen Cyanamide is used as the active ingredient in registered plant growth regulator products in certain markets. Registration, crop use, application timing and dosage are jurisdiction-specific.
Can industrial Cyanamide be applied directly to grapes or kiwifruit? Industrial Cyanamide raw material should not automatically be treated as a registered agricultural product. Agricultural use must follow the registration and approved label requirements applicable in the destination market.
